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 109539-16-4 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,0,9,5,3 and 9 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 1 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 109539-16:
(8*1)+(7*0)+(6*9)+(5*5)+(4*3)+(3*9)+(2*1)+(1*6)=134
134 % 10 = 4
So 109539-16-4 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Copper-catalyzed reactions of organotitanium reagents. Highly selective SN2′-allylation and conjugate addition

Arai, Masayuki,Lipshutz, Bruce H.,Nakamura, Eiichi

, p. 5709 - 5718 (2007/10/02)

In the presence of a catalytic amount of CuI·ILiCl, alkyltitanium (RTi(O-I-Pr)3) and titanate reagents (RnTi(O-i-Pr)5-nLi) undergo highly selective SN2′-alkylation reactions with allylic chlorides and allylic diethylphosphates in high yields. The regioselectivity of the reaction is as high as 99.8%. The reaction proceeds with excellent anti-stereoselectivity with respect to the nucleophile and the leaving group, and exhibits high 1,2-anti-diastereoselectivity with a δ-chiral allylic chloride. The catalytic copper reagent is also a mild agent to transfer an alkyl group to an enone in the presence of Me3SiCl. The alkyltitanium-based catalytic reagent selectively reacts with an allylic phosphate rather than with an enone, while in the presence of a silicon activator, it reacts preferentially with the enone rather than with the phosphate. 1H NMR studies on a mixture of Me2CuLi and TiCl(O-i-Pr)3 provided information on reagent composition.

Copper-Catalyzed Reactions of Organotitanium Reagents. Highly SN2'- and Anti-Selective and Diastereo- and Chemoselective Alkylation of Allylic Chlorides and Phosphates

Arai, Masayuki,Nakamura, Eiichi,Lipshutz, Bruce H.

, p. 5489 - 5491 (2007/10/02)

Organotitanium reagents undergo Cu(I)-catalyzed SN2' substitution reactions with allylic chlorides and phosphates in a regio-, stereo-, and chemoselective manner: in the presence of Me3SiCl or Me3SiOSO2CF3, they undergo preferential conjugate addition to enones.

ORGANOMANGANESE (II) REAGENTS XVI: COPPER-CATALYZED 1,4-ADDITION OF ORGANOMANGANESE CHLORIDES TO CONJUGATED ENONES

Cahiez, Gerard,Alami, Mouad

, p. 3541 - 3544 (2007/10/02)

Copper-catalyzed conjugate addition of organomanganese chlorides to conjugated enones in THF, at 0 deg C, leads to the 1,4-addition products in high yields.The scope of the reaction is very large and the results are generally better than those obtained from organomagnesium compounds in the presence of a copper salts as well as from organocopper or cuprate reagents.Furthermore organomanganese chlorides are indisputably cheaper and more stable than the latter.
